Meaning of "look at the bank"
look at the bank: This phrase typically means to examine or review one's financial situation, particularly in the context of personal or business finances. It can involve checking account balances, transactions, budgets, or financial records. This phrase is often used when discussing financial planning, assessments, or decisions regarding money matters
